About Nistarium
Nistarium licenses Patent US 12,624,826 B1 - Adaptive Optical Obfuscation System for Blocking Electronic Detection and Providing Visual Concealment. Our technology returns privacy to individuals. We also focus on organizations looking to grant privacy and digital security to museums, religious facilities and entertainment venues. Our vision protects personal privacy, intellectual property, and returns anonymity in public and private locations. We envision a world where entertainers, politicians, soldiers, police, and anyone looking for privacy can find it under a shield powered by Nistar Core.
